Protesters Halt Operations at Starbucks Following Arrest of Two Black Men

In a significant incident that unfolded in Philadelphia, a Starbucks location was effectively shut down due to protests sparked by the arrest of two Black men. This event has led to widespread condemnation and demands for accountability. The CEO of Starbucks, Marcus Green, has taken full responsibility for the “unacceptable” situation, stating that changes to company policy are urgently needed.

The controversy began when a viral video surfaced, showing police escorting the two men out of the Starbucks store. Witnesses asserted that the men had not committed any offense. Reports indicate that the store manager called 911 after the men requested the restroom code, which was restricted to paying customers. They had returned to their table, awaiting a business partner, when they were confronted by law enforcement officers.

In a public statement released over the weekend, Green emphasized that Starbucks stands against discrimination and racial profiling. He expressed a desire to meet the arrested individuals to personally apologize. However, his reassurances have not quelled the anger of advocacy groups such as Black Lives Matter, which demand the firing of the store manager who initiated the police call.

Green clarified that the store manager acted under the company’s established protocols, which he believes must be revised to prevent similar incidents in the future. “The reasons for contacting the police were misguided,” he remarked. “The escalation of the situation was not intended.”

As protests gained momentum, demonstrators have urged Starbucks customers to redirect their spending to organizations that champion racial justice initiatives in Philadelphia. Protesters are determined to drive home their message, even addressing the manager directly in their demonstrations. It remains uncertain whether the manager present during the protests was the same individual who called 911.

A significant police presence has been reported at the site of the protests, which have continued to grow. Social media updates indicated that, within hours of the demonstrations commencing, the store had essentially been vacated, with only corporate staff remaining inside. As of the latest updates, the store manager has reportedly been dismissed.

The broader implications for Starbucks’ corporate policies regarding racial profiling and discrimination are yet to be clarified.
